Feeling overwhelmed by nervousness? You're not alone. Many people struggle with dealing with these feelings on a daily basis. The good news is that there are practical strategies you can use to {calmyour mind and find tranquility.
- Start by practicing regular exercise. Even a short walk can enhance your mood and ease stress hormones.
- Mindfulness exercises can be incredibly effective for relaxing your mind and body.
- Make time for hobbies that you enjoy. Immersing yourself to something you love can provide a welcome escape from anxious thoughts.
- Schedule self-care activities like getting enough sleep, eating healthy foods, and spending time in nature. These simple habits can make a big impact in your overall well-being.
If you're struggling to cope with anxiety on your own, don't hesitate to reach out a mental health professional. They can provide personalized support and guidance to help you flourish.
A Path to Serenity: Conquering Anxiety
Anxiety can seem like a relentless tide, threatening to consume you. It's a common struggle, but you don't have to be subject to it. Cultivating peace within is a journey that requires commitment. Start by practicing mindfulness techniques like deep breathing and meditation. Such methods can help center you in the present moment, reducing the grip of anxious thoughts. Additionally, seek out supportive connections with others. Sharing your concerns with loved ones or joining a support group can provide invaluable comfort. Remember, there is help available.
